The Agriculture Council of America (ACA) will host National Agriculture Day on March 14, 2019.

The Agriculture Council of America (ACA) will host National Agriculture Day on March 14, 2019. This will mark the 46th anniversary of National Ag Day which is celebrated in classrooms and communities across the country. The theme for National Ag Day 2019 is "Agriculture: Food for Life."

Across Kentucky - March 15, 2019

The University of Kentucky is hosting a number of Kentucky Agriculture Training Schools this year at the Research and Education Center in Princeton.  KATS Coordinator Lori Rogers talks about the schools, the topics being covered, the training participants receive and how to sign up.

Across Kentucky - March 12, 2019

More than 300 Kentucky Farm Bureau members met with Senate Majority Leader Mitch McConnell and Senator Rand Paul during the annual Congressional Tour.  Senators McConnell and Paul talked about important agriculture issues including trade, industrial hemp, socialism, the impact of Farm Bureau and the possibility of association health plans.

Market Closes - March 5, 2019

And the beat goes on – corn and beans closed little changed as the China trade situation drags on with rumors of a big deal, but confirmation still days/weeks away.  Live Cattle closed mixed and Feeders were lower across the board. Lean Hog futures closed higher, posting the highest closes since February 15.

Market Closes - March 4, 2019

CBOT futures closed mixed with soybeans and wheat ending near the day’s lows.Early support came from President Trump’s encouraging remark about a US/China trade deal.  Live Cattle futures closed lower, led by the nearby April LC dropping 1.20 to 128.35.

'Safety: Know Your Limits' is Theme of Agricultural Safety Awareness Program Week, March 3-9

Across the country, county and state Farm Bureaus are making safety a priority through the Agricultural Safety Awareness Program (ASAP). As part of ASAP, March 3-9 has been designated as Agricultural Safety Awareness Week.
